    I put the Packers chances of making the playoffs at about 40% right now. I think they have a decent chance of getting to 9-7, but 9-7 might not be enough. They're only 4-4 in NFC games, and both Atlanta and Detroit have the head to head tie-breaker over them. They do have the tie-breaker over Dallas. 10-6 might be a bridge too far, although that could change if Rodgers can make it back sometime in December.
